A bill to protect American job creation by striking the Federal mandate on employers to offer health insurance.
American Job Protection Act
This bill amends the Internal Revenue Code to repeal the requirement for certain large employers to offer full-time employees and their dependents minimum essential health insurance coverage under an employer-sponsored health plan (commonly referred to as the employer mandate) and related reporting requirements regarding employer-provided health insurance coverage.
